Navigating Political Candidacy and Youth Engagement
This chapter delves into how political parties choose parliamentary candidates, focusing on the balance between local demands and central office influences. The discussion underscores the importance of local ties for candidates, the challenges of engaging young people in politics, and the need for political education in schools. Additionally, the speakers reflect on their personal experiences and literary inspirations while addressing the complexities of political involvement for youth.
